From 49bd184f8a9c5bb636cb7225647003044c617752 Mon Sep 17 00:00:00 2001
From: haoxuan <haoxuan>
Date: 星期四, 11 四月 2024 18:11:57 +0800
Subject: [PATCH] 新增产量登记表的接口联调,大概80个左右的字段调试+重组表格数据回数的一个一条数据对3条数据
---
src/views/productManage/productRegisterForm/addProductRegisterPage.vue | 107 +++++++++++++++++++++++++++++++++++++++++------------
1 files changed, 82 insertions(+), 25 deletions(-)
diff --git a/src/views/productManage/productRegisterForm/addProductRegisterPage.vue b/src/views/productManage/productRegisterForm/addProductRegisterPage.vue
index a49e07b..b1d310b 100644
--- a/src/views/productManage/productRegisterForm/addProductRegisterPage.vue
+++ b/src/views/productManage/productRegisterForm/addProductRegisterPage.vue
@@ -967,50 +967,107 @@
let tableData = JSON.parse(
JSON.stringify(this.tableData)
);
- // row.pieceNumber11||row.pieceNumber12||row.pieceNumber13||row.pieceNumber14||row.pieceNumber21||row.pieceNumber22||row.pieceNumber23||row.pieceNumber24||row.pieceNumber31||row.pieceNumber32||row.pieceNumber33||row.pieceNumber34){
-
+ form.bucketCocoonNumber=Number(form.bucketCocoonNumber)
+ form.circle=Number(form.circle)
+ form.fallingSilkBucketOne=Number(form.fallingSilkBucketOne)
+ form.fallingSilkBucketThree=Number(form.fallingSilkBucketThree)
+ form.fallingSilkBucketTwo=Number(form.fallingSilkBucketTwo)
+ form.fallingSilkCocoonNumber=Number(form.fallingSilkCocoonNumber)
+ form.groupNumber=Number(form.groupNumber)
+ form.hourYield=Number(form.hourYield)
+ form.marketId=Number(form.marketId)
+ form.record=Number(form.record)
+ form.theorySilkAmount=Number(form.theorySilkAmount)
+ form.total=Number(form.total)
+ form.vehicleSpeed=Number(form.vehicleSpeed)
+ form.workshopId =Number(form.workshopId)
+ delete form.isfallingSilkBucketOne
+ delete form.isfallingSilkBucketThree
+ delete form.isfallingSilkBucketTwo
for(let i in tableData){
circles.push({
- allYield:tableData[i].allYield1||'', //浜ч噺
+ allYield:Number(tableData[i].allYield1)||0, //浜ч噺
carNumber:tableData[i].carNumber,
circle:1,//鍥炴暟
- oneYield:tableData[i].oneYield1||'',// 鍙颁骇
- value1:tableData[i].pieceNumber11||'',//鐗囨暟
- value2:tableData[i].pieceNumber12||'',//鐗囨暟
- value3:tableData[i].pieceNumber13||'',//鐗囨暟
- value4:tableData[i].pieceNumber14||'',//鐗囨暟
+ oneYield:Number(tableData[i].oneYield1)||0,// 鍙颁骇
+ pieceNumber:[
+ {
+ pieceNumber:1,
+ value:Number(tableData[i].pieceNumber11)||0
+ },
+ {
+ pieceNumber:2,
+ value:Number(tableData[i].pieceNumber12)||0
+ },
+ {
+ pieceNumber:3,
+ value:Number(tableData[i].pieceNumber13)||0
+ },
+ {
+ pieceNumber:4,
+ value:Number(tableData[i].pieceNumber14)||0
+ },
+ ],
reelingdiscount:tableData[i].reelingdiscount1||'', //缂姌
// yieldRegisterId:''
})
circles.push({
- allYield:tableData[i].allYield2||'', //浜ч噺
+ allYield:Number(tableData[i].allYield2)||0, //浜ч噺
carNumber:tableData[i].carNumber,
circle:2,//鍥炴暟
- oneYield:tableData[i].oneYield2||'',// 鍙颁骇
- value1:tableData[i].pieceNumber21||'',//鐗囨暟
- value2:tableData[i].pieceNumber22||'',//鐗囨暟
- value3:tableData[i].pieceNumber23||'',//鐗囨暟
- value4:tableData[i].pieceNumber24||'',//鐗囨暟
+ pieceNumber:[
+ {
+ pieceNumber:1,
+ value:Number(tableData[i].pieceNumber21)||0
+ },
+ {
+ pieceNumber:2,
+ value:Number(tableData[i].pieceNumber22)||0
+ },
+ {
+ pieceNumber:3,
+ value:Number(tableData[i].pieceNumber23)||0
+ },
+ {
+ pieceNumber:4,
+ value:Number(tableData[i].pieceNumber24)||0
+ },
+ ],
+ oneYield:Number(tableData[i].oneYield2)||0,// 鍙颁骇
reelingdiscount:tableData[i].reelingdiscount2||'', //缂姌
// yieldRegisterId:''
})
circles.push({
- allYield:tableData[i].allYield3||'', //浜ч噺
+ allYield:Number(tableData[i].allYield3)||0, //浜ч噺
carNumber:tableData[i].carNumber,
circle:3,//鍥炴暟
- oneYield:tableData[i].oneYield3||'',// 鍙颁骇
- value1:tableData[i].pieceNumber31||'',//鐗囨暟
- value2:tableData[i].pieceNumber32||'',//鐗囨暟
- value3:tableData[i].pieceNumber33||'',//鐗囨暟
- value4:tableData[i].pieceNumber34||'',//鐗囨暟
+ oneYield:Number(tableData[i].oneYield3)||0,// 鍙颁骇
+ pieceNumber:[
+ {
+ pieceNumber:1,
+ value:Number(tableData[i].pieceNumber31)||0
+ },
+ {
+ pieceNumber:2,
+ value:Number(tableData[i].pieceNumber32)||0
+ },
+ {
+ pieceNumber:3,
+ value:Number(tableData[i].pieceNumber33)||0
+ },
+ {
+ pieceNumber:4,
+ value:Number(tableData[i].pieceNumber34)||0
+ },
+ ],
reelingdiscount:tableData[i].reelingdiscount3||'', //缂姌
// yieldRegisterId:''
})
items.push({
- hourYield:tableData[i].hourYield||'',
- carNumber:tableData[i].carNumber||'',
- oneYield:tableData[i].oneYield||'',
- peopleYield:tableData[i].peopleYield||'',
+ hourYield:Number(tableData[i].hourYield)||0,
+ carNumber:tableData[i].carNumber,
+ oneYield:Number(tableData[i].oneYield)||0,
+ peopleYield:Number(tableData[i].peopleYield)||0,
personReelingdiscount:tableData[i].personReelingdiscount||'',
// yieldRegisterId:''
})
@@ -1033,7 +1090,7 @@
type: "success",
});
this.$router.push({
- path: "/productManage/silkRegisterForm",
+ path: "/productManage/productRegisterForm",
});
}
this.isAddloading = false;
--
Gitblit v1.8.0